The Calendar Year vs. the Astronomical Year
A calendar year consists of 365 days in a common year and 366 days in a leap year. The Earth’s orbit around the Sun, however, takes approximately 365.2422 days, which is why leap years are added every four years to keep our calendar aligned with the astronomical cycle. When calculating how many seconds are in 11 years, we must decide whether to use a purely calendar‑based approach or incorporate the extra fractional day that reflects the Earth’s true orbital period.

Step‑by‑Step Calculation
1. Determine the Number of Leap Years in 11 Years Within any 11‑year span, the number of leap years depends on the starting point. For simplicity, we can assume a typical 11‑year period that includes two leap years (e.g., 2023‑2033 contains the leap years 2024 and 2028).
- Common years: 11 – 2 = 9 years
- Leap years: 2 years
2. Convert Years to Days
- Days from common years: 9 × 365 = 3,285 days
- Days from leap years: 2 × 366 = 732 days
- Total days = 3,285 + 732 = 4,017 days
3. Convert Days to Hours
Each day has 24 hours, so:
- Hours = 4,017 × 24 = 96,408 hours
4. Convert Hours to Minutes
There are 60 minutes in an hour:
- Minutes = 96,408 × 60 = 5,784,480 minutes
5. Convert Minutes to Seconds
Finally, multiply by 60 seconds per minute: - Seconds = 5,784,480 × 60 = 347,068,800 seconds
